Facility

2600 sq. ft. of floor area, 4500 sq. ft. of wall displays.

Description

Satellite hall under the Saskatchewan Sports Hall of Fame and Museum (Regina) established to recognize the sports heritage of the community of North Battleford.

American Champions and Barrier Breakers
Event's details
February 17, 2012-July 30, 2012

All Day Event
Location: USGA Museum, Far Hills, NJ-NJ


"American Champions and Barrier Breakers: Jackie Robinson, Joe Louis and Althea Gibson,” exhibit will be on display from Feb. 17, 2012, to July 30, 2012, and celebrates the lives of Robinson, Louis and Gibson, their sports achievements and their important legacies. The exhibit will feature artifacts, documents and photographs of these three American icons while calling attention to the numerous contributions that African Americans have made to golf for more than a century.
